*Okuma, Sandvik and Iscar to demonstrate 15 to 30% improvement in 
machining efficiency *

*IMTS - September 9-13, 2014*-- You already know that post processor's 
create time delays, introduce errors and make it harder to take 
advantage of new machines. Now a team led by the Organization for 
Machine Automation and Control (OMAC) has shown how to enable a 15 to 30 
percent increase in manufacturing efficiency by replacing post's with a 
standardized CAM file.

Any CNC program can be optimized by modernizing its tooling, but the 
optimizer must meet all the design and manufacturing requirements. 
Gcodes do not have this information, so in 2012 OMAC issued a call to 
develop standardized CAM files. In response new ISO standard interfaces 
have been added to Catia, NX and Mastercam, and in May of 2013 Sandvik 
and Iscar started cloud services to optimize programs using the new 
files. The results are 15 to 30% better programs where the new 
efficiency can be realized as time savings, tool wear savings, or some 
combination of both.

At IMTS 2014, a test part developed by Boeing Commercial Airplane will 
be machined every day at 11AM in the Okuma booth. The titanium part will 
be machined using the original process, and then two optimized 
processes. A new CAM file simulator on the control will direct the 
machining and validate the design and manufacturing requirements. There 
will be an opportunity to discuss the technology with STEP Tools, Inc. 
at 2PM each day in the South building conference room.

  About STEP Tools, Inc.

STEP Tools, Inc., founded in 1991, provides software tools to enable 
design and manufacturing information sharing. Its products leverage 
standards to enable new types of manufacturing efficiency. The 
ST-Developer® libraries are used for CAD translation in a large 
percentage of the world's workstations. The STEP-NC Machine® system 
enables direct execution of standardized CAM files on the CNC control.
